Scroll savant get a really good feat at level 10. Trickster get their best feat at level 10. Those 2 classes don't mix well together.
Try a evil 20 scroll savant universalist,
CC master that can empower(univeralist ability) + maximize(rod) a lot faster then anyone else and become the best healer in the game, for a price.
Trickster are probably better as Thassilonian Specialist evocation + 1 lvl of vivisectionist, If you want to focus on damage and rogue skills.
Without any bonus, 24+10 = 34 UMD minimum
Use a scroll 20 + caster level
Use a wand 20
So when you say boosting int/cha, do scroll savants use int or charisma for using a scroll? Or both?
With the trait Clever Wordplay, he would use Int instead of Charisma, so I would lower my charisma to 7 since I am already maxing int.
